52-Week High Club

American Eagle Outfiters Inc. (NYSE: AEO) hit a yearly high of $18.08 after the clothing vendor announced that it had raised its 3Q09 EPS estimate to $0.24-$0.26 from $0.22-$0.25.  

Anheuser-Busch InBev SA (NYSE: BUD) hit a yearly high of $48.19 after yesterday’s announcement that the company would be setting its theme park business to private equity firm Blackstone Group for $2.7 billion.

Colgate-Palmolive Company (NYSE: CL) hit a yearly high of $79.03 after the company declared a quarterly cash dividend of $0.44 per common share, payable on the 13th of November to all those in possession of the shares as of October 26th.

3Com Corporation (NASDAQ: COMS) hit s yearly high of %5.54 after yesterday’s annoumcement that the company had entered into contracts with the Republic of Korea Army and Republic of Korea Air Force to upgrade their local area networks.
